What is mod 6F stands for?

October 19th, 2020, 17:48

Hi guys!

What is mod 6F do exactly? Patient is WD20EACS-11BHUB0 with bad sectors in SA, all of the mod 6F copies damaged. Can I clear it or repair it, or must be replaced with a healthy one? Anyone can help me out about this?

Thanks for further! :)

Mod 6F never reads. Its probably a carryover from older drives. It can be ignored.

Re: What is mod 6F stands for?

October 19th, 2020, 19:14

Mod 6F is a log file for background media scan.
It can be cleared on this drive.
